static krb5_error_code
LDAP_addmod_integer(krb5_context context,
LDAPMod *** mods, int modop,
const char *attribute, unsigned long l)
{
krb5_error_code ret;
char *buf;
ret = asprintf(&buf, "%ld", l);
if (ret < 0) {
krb5_set_error_string(context, "asprintf: out of memory:");
return ret;
}
ret = LDAP_addmod(mods, modop, attribute, buf);
free (buf);
return ret;
}
